IT support and maintenance

Up to 39 weeks training plus an Employment Development Placement

Training coursesCourse description
This course is based on the NVQ Installing & Supporting IT Systems, but it also gives you more ‘hands-on’ experience in upgrading and maintaining computers.

Pre-entry Requirements:
Reasonable standard of numeracy and good comprehension and literacy skills, plus manual dexterity required. You will need to be able to lift and move computer equipment. A College assessment will be undertaken.

Course Content:
Using your IT skills you will learn about fault diagnostics, software installation and support and how to identify and replace defective components.

What Qualifications can I get?
City and Guilds 4324-01 – Level 1 NVQ for IT Practitioners
City and Guilds 4324-02 - Level 2 NVQ for IT Practitioners
City and Guilds 4324-03 – Level 3 NVQ for IT Professionals
A+ or Net+ training is available for suitable candidates.

Employment Opportunities:
You can find employment in a variety of organisations including corporate companies, the retail industry and Local Government on the Help Desk or in the IT Support Department. You may choose self-employment. Your Employment Development Manager will help you make the right connections.
